Jaipur – The Pink City of India
Jaipur – The Pink City of India
Jaipur, the vibrant capital of Rajasthan, is famously known as the Pink City for its trademark terracotta-colored buildings. Founded in 1727 by Maharaja Sawai Jai Singh II, Jaipur beautifully blends royal heritage, rich traditions, and modern charm.
A trip to Jaipur is like stepping back into the era of kings and queens. The city is dotted with majestic forts, grand palaces, and bustling bazaars. The Amber Fort, perched on a hilltop, is a stunning example of Rajput architecture, offering breathtaking views and an insight into royal life. The City Palace, still home to the royal family, and the Hawa Mahal, with its intricate lattice windows, showcase Jaipur’s regal elegance.
For astronomy lovers, the Jantar Mantar, a UNESCO World Heritage Site, reveals the scientific genius of the Rajputs. Beyond monuments, Jaipur is a paradise for shoppers—famous for its textiles, jewelry, handicrafts, and vibrant markets like Johari Bazaar and Bapu Bazaar.
The city is also a hub of culture, with traditional Rajasthani folk performances, authentic cuisine, and colorful festivals that bring its streets alive. Whether you’re exploring its heritage or enjoying its hospitality, Jaipur offers an unforgettable glimpse into Rajasthan’s royal past and lively present.
